Steps to make Thai chicken wings (peek gai todd):
  1. Lets make the marinate. Best if use coriander root however, it is difficult to find so cutting the stems will work too. Also add peeled garlic and in a motar start pounding.
  2. Here is what it will look like. Add little bit salt if you wish but dont forget the seasoning sauce is already salty
  3. Rub the marinate to the wings. Add a dash of sugar and half dash of msg
  4. 2-3 splash equals about 1 tbl spoon each sauce of seasing sauce and oyster sauce to the wings
  5. Next sprinkle lightly the tempura flour. There is a myth that the more of this batter the better. This is not true! Just coat lightly this is key to this recipe. Next fry the wings in canola oil only for about 14 min or until golden brown.
  6. Lets make the sauce
  7. In a motar starting pounding the chili and garlic
  8. Place in a bowl
  9. Add fish sauce until it covers the garlic and pepper half way
  10. Squeeze lemon until covered. The trick to this sauce it needs to have equal parts of fish sauce to lemon. Balance of salty to sour
  11. Add sugar and msg to taste. Make sure you taste it to your liking. Maybe add little more lemon or sugar to your taste
